Snapchat offers a fantastic feature that allows you to bring someone to the top of your discussion list. When you pin someone on Snapchat, the chat always shows at the very top of the chat screen. Make sure you don’t miss any snaps or texts from that buddy.
How To Unpin Someone On Snapchat

- Tap the “Chat” button at the bottom of the page in the Snapchat app.
- Find a pinned conversation you would like to remove the pin from. You’ll notice a red “Pin” icon to the right, and it should be at the top of the list.
- Tap and hold the conversation until you see the pop-up menu.
- Tap “Chat Settings.”
- Tap “Unpin Conversation.”
- You may also unpin someone by completely removing them from your Friends list; simply move to their site and click the “Unfriend” option.
How To Unpin Your BFF On Snapchat

If you have Snapchat Plus, you may pin one person to the top of the discussion list as your #1 BFF. It’ll be there until you unpin this BFF.
- At the bottom of the page, click the “Chat” icon.
- Find your BFF. The avatar of the person should have a smiley face emoji in the lower left corner.
- When the pop-up menu appears, tap and hold the chat.
- Then choose “Pinned as your #1 BFF.” The checkmark would go.
- Tap “Done.”

How to Unpin Someone on Snapchat After Their Account Is Deleted
When you delete or disable someone’s Snapchat account, you must block and unblock them to remove them from the list of unpinned conversations or chats.
- Force-close the Snapchat app. To force-close Snapchat on a PC, use the keys Ctrl and R simultaneously.
- After force-stopping your Snapchat app, Clear cache data.
(On an Android device, enter “Settings” > “Apps,” search for and open the Snapchat app, then touch “Storage” and “Clear cache.”)
- Reopen Snapchat, go to the pinned deleted account, block the person, and then after a few seconds, unblock them.

How to Solve the Snapchat Unpin Issue
Do you still have Snapchat unpinning troubles other than deleting, banning, and unfriending? There are a few possible solutions.
- Block and unblock the person.
If you are unable to unpin a discussion with someone who is no longer a Snapchat friend, block and unblock the person to unpin the conversation.
- Delete Snapchat, redownload it, then log back into your Snapchat account.
If you’ve been blocked by someone and don’t want their discussion to be pinned, consider uninstalling Snapchat. Redownload it and log back into your account after that.
